The big fire near you is on the far side of Mt Hood, and in late August the wind on your side of the mountains almost always blows from the ocean toward the fire, not from the fire toward the house — which is why the monitor eight miles away reads Good today even with 85,000 acres burning nearby.
Our best guess for the worst of your three days is around 32, which a phone app calls 'Good': maybe a faint haze on the ridgelines, fine for kids, hikes and dinner outside. What would spoil it is an east wind pushing that plume back over the crest, or one of the smaller uncontained fires south and west of you growing into something serious, and you would see either coming two or three days out.

The controlling fact is geometry plus the prevailing wind: Grasshopper, the only large fire in range at 85,114 acres, sits 17.4 miles due east, while Mt Hood's crest and the standard late-August onshore/marine regime both lie between it and the house — which is why the monitor 8.7 miles away reads 13 today with that fire fully active. A fire that size at 20% containment will absolutely still be producing smoke on Aug 28-30 (Oregon fires this large routinely burn into late September and are ended by rain, not by lines), so this is a transport question, not a source question, and transport currently and climatologically points the wrong way for smoke to reach Welches. I did not, however, take the terrain-shield argument at face value: Austin (1,430 acres, 0% contained, 19.4 mi S), Mitchell (12.5 mi S), The Narrows (14 mi SSW), Regan Hill (17.8 mi W) and High Lava (1,211 acres, 0% contained, 38.9 mi NNW) are all on the house's side of the crest, with High Lava roughly upwind in the climatological NW flow — those, plus a brand-new ignition in the Sandy or Clackamas drainage over the next fifteen days, are the realistic paths to a bad weekend, not Grasshopper. Against that, the 24-hour averaging window is a genuine dampener: a smoky morning from nocturnal valley drainage, which is what 'patchy smoke then areas of fog' already describes, gets diluted by a clean afternoon and rarely pushes the daily average over 100 without sustained synoptic transport.

It is a judgement, never scored against an outcome. Nobody forecasts smoke this far out: NOAA's smoke model runs 48 hours and the EPA's air-quality forecast is for tomorrow. Two-to-six weeks ahead is what meteorologists call the predictability desert. Anyone giving you a number for the trip right now - us included - is giving you a base rate with a story attached.
AQI here means the highest 24-hour PM2.5 value touching a day, at the house, on the local monitor scale - the same thing your phone shows.
